Vintage Heart, Modern Hustle
Real talk—the P-Bass is the foundation. It’s the sound you hear in your head, the one that laid the groundwork for pretty much everything. Fender’s American Professional Classic Precision Bass takes that iconic ’60s thump and gives it the modern playability today’s musician demands. Finished in a stunning Faded Lake Placid Blue, this bass has the look of a well-loved classic but plays like a brand-new machine, fresh off the bench.
The magic starts with a resonant alder body—the classic Fender tonewood—delivering a balanced, lively tone with punchy mids and a rock-solid low end. It’s the perfect canvas for the vintage-inspired Coastline ’60 Split Single-Coil pickup, which is slightly overwound to give you that extra warmth, focus, and grit when you dig in.
Effortless Playability
This isn’t your grandpa’s clunky old bass. The Modern “C” maple neck is crafted for comfort and speed, fitting your hand like a glove for hours of fatigue-free playing. The satin urethane finish feels broken-in from the first note, never sticky or slow. Paired with a 9.5″ radius maple fingerboard and 20 medium-jumbo frets, you get a buttery-smooth surface that makes everything from walking basslines to intricate fills feel effortless.
Rock-Solid Vintage Hardware
From the 4-saddle vintage-style bridge with steel saddles to the classic “Lollipop” tuning machines, every piece of hardware is built for reliability and authentic Fender style. This bass doesn’t just look the part—it holds its tuning with incredible stability, so you can count on it night after night. And with the Greasebucket™ Tone System, you can roll off highs without adding bass or losing your fundamental tone, keeping your sound defined and present in any mix.
